    Hola!
    Are you looking for a time-out in a little village with abundant greenery, fresh air, rolling hills and beautiful forests around, not too far from the sea? If you love nature, hiking and gardening you are absolutely right here!

    We live in the Asturian countryside, in a tranquil little village (pop. around 20 people) between small hills, forests and a lot of greenery 35 minutes away from really nice beaches and with many hiking opportunities around. The next small cities are 25 mins by car (Villaviciosa and Infiesto), the next big city 40 mins (Gijon), the next bigger village 5 km. If you love nature, calm, walking or hiking you are absolutely right here.
    We that is currently me and my border collie mix. We have a veggie garden and a house I renovated and a parking space for a campervan with really nice views and a terrace just in front of it.

  • What else ...

    What else ...

    There is a lot of beautiful nature to explore around here. If you like hills and forests, waterfalls, rivers, the sea and rural life - you are just right! Once a month there is a handicraft market not far away, And there are beautiful beaches a half hour buy car - some even have dinosaur footprints. The area is famous for its sidra (cidre) apple trees and sidra-making.
